Qualifications

Job Requirements:

  • Baccalaureate Degree OR Associates Degree in Medical Technology, Clinical Laboratory Science, or a chemical, physical, or biological science.
  • Current knowledge of clinical laboratory techniques and principles
  • ASCP or equivalent
    • Certification within a specific area, i.e. M(ASCP), H(ASCP), C(ASCP) qualifies.
    • Certification must be maintained without lapse during employment.
      • If certification does lapse, job will be downgraded to Medical Laboratory Scientist (non-certified) until certification is reinstated.:
  • Three (3) years of clinical laboratory experience as a Medical Technologist, Clinical Laboratory Scientist, Medical Laboratory Scientist, or Medical Lab Tech within a clinical laboratory.

Preferred Job Requirements:

  • Five (5) years clinical laboratory experience
